Senior SAPUI5/BTP Developer (relocation to Cyprus) - EPAM Romania
Apply externally

Senior SAPUI5/BTP Developer (relocation to Cyprus)

Published 17.11.2025 | Expires 01.01.2026

Job description

We are looking for a Senior SAPUI5/BTP Developer to join our team, focusing on the Global Adoption Experience Framework. This position involves close collaboration with client engineers to deliver high-quality solutions.

You will work in a collaborative environment that applies the Scaled Agile Framework to support flexibility and continuous improvement. The role includes active participation in client workshops and regular teamwork sessions to align project objectives and improve communication. Join us to contribute to impactful SAP projects and develop your expertise in a supportive and innovative setting.

This position offers a hybrid setup with the flexibility to work from any location in Cyprus, whether it's your home or our office in Nicosia.

Responsibilities

  • Participate in frontend development with UI5 Freestyle or Fiori Elements
  • Develop new frontend components for real-time interaction with specific Cloud functionality
  • Integrate BTP applications with SAP and non-SAP systems using services such as OData, REST and SOAP
  • Assist in design and development of SAP Customer Portal applications
  • Collaborate with business analysts and stakeholders to translate business requirements into technical solutions and design scalable architecture
  • Optimize application performance, conduct code reviews and ensure high-quality, responsive and secure code
  • Provide technical expertise, lead development efforts and mentor junior developers
  • Participate in agile development processes, manage project activities and assist in resolving production incidents
  • Create and maintain technical documentation including system configurations, installation procedures and guidelines

Requirements

  • 4+ years experience in SAPUI5 development
  • Proficiency in SAPUI5, Fiori, JavaScript, HTML5 and CSS
  • Experience with SAP BTP and its services such as Cloud Application Programming Model (CAP)
  • Knowledge of integration technologies including OData, REST and SOAP
  • Familiarity with backend programming languages such as Java or ABAP
  • Background in SAP HANA and SQL is often required
  • Strong problem-solving, analytical and communication skills
  • Experience in agile development environments
  • Excellent English communication skills at B2 level or higher
EPAM Romania

EPAM Romania

92 active ads

4.18

127 reviews

Career opportunities

Salary package

Work-life balance

Management

Procedures and values

Job criteria

Employee Senior level (> 5 years)
Type of job Full-time
Cities Remote